In their preseason opener against the Los Angeles Chargers on August 13, the Houston Texans lost cornerback Ja'Marcus Ingram to an injury. Ingram appeared to suffer a dislocated shoulder during the third quarter, prompting attention from the medical staff. Backup quarterback Graham Mertz also exited the game earlier due to an undisclosed injury. This continues a troubling trend for the Texans, who are already dealing with several injuries as the preseason progresses. Updates on Ingram's condition are expected as the team evaluates his injury further.
